To activate your connection:
1.
From the Home screen, press
and then tap
Settings
.
2.
In a single motion touch and slide the
Wi-Fi
slider to the
right to turn it on
. The slider color indicates
the activation status.
3.
Tap
Wi-Fi Direct
.
4.
Tap
Scan
and select the single device name to begin
the connection process to another Wi-Fi Direct
compatible device.
– or –
Tap
Multi-connect
➔
Scan
and select all the device
names to begin the connection process to these Wi-Fi
Direct compatible devices.
Note:
The target device must also have Wi-Fi Direct service
active and running before it can be detected by your
device.
5.
Tap
Done
. The direct connection is then established.
Confirm
appears in the Status bar.
6.
When prompted to complete the connection, the
recipient should tap
OK
. Your status field now reads
“Connected” and your connected device is listed within
the Wi-Fi Direct devices listing.
To give your Wi-Fi Direct connection a unique name:
It can be difficult to pair to external devices if all you have is
a generic name (ex: Android 12345). It is recommended you
provide your connection with a unique name.
1.
From the Home screen, press
and then tap
Settings
➔
Wi-Fi
➔
Wi-Fi Direct
.
2.
Press
and then tap
Rename device
.
3.
Edit the current name and tap
OK
to save the new
identification.
